Output 527520ea4ef0b1c12618882000fbe6c4d4df81cc9fa4cbc1f2aaa986f12bd967:1

value
513687
script pubkey
OP_0 OP_PUSHBYTES_20 95e0c3ee9b4652ffa0bbc07b94222209caf08e91
address
bc1qjhsv8m5mgef0lg9mcpaegg3zp890pr53rgrdnv
transaction
527520ea4ef0b1c12618882000fbe6c4d4df81cc9fa4cbc1f2aaa986f12bd967
spent
true